German Students' Neo-Nazi Gestures at Auschwitz and Bergen-Belsen Spark Outrage

German high school students from Bielefeld and Görlitz performed neo-Nazi gestures at Auschwitz and sang nationalist chants at Bergen-Belsen, prompting disciplinary actions but raising concerns about rising far-right extremism.

Dreyfus Affair Exhibition Highlights Resurgence of Antisemitism

A new exhibition in Paris examines the Dreyfus Affair, highlighting the resurgence of antisemitism and drawing parallels between late 19th-century France and the present day. Progressive Jews Criticize Trump Administration's Antisemitism Crackdown

Progressive Jews criticize the Trump administration's strong stance against antisemitism, viewing recent actions such as funding withdrawals and arrests as a greater threat than ongoing anti-Israel protests and antisemitic attacks.
